Understanding the Mechanics of Plinko
The mechanics governing plinko are beautifully straightforward. The game’s board is comprised of a series of pegs arranged in a pyramid-like structure. When a ball is released from the top, it inevitably encounters these pegs, causing it to bounce left or right with each collision. Because the bounces are random, predicting the final destination of the ball is impossible, adding to the excitement. Each slot at the bottom of the board corresponds to a different payout value, usually represented as a multiplier of the initial bet.
The player’s initial decision involves selecting the bet amount and, in some variations of the game, the number of lines they wish to play. Betting a larger sum increases the potential payoff, but also heightens the risk. Different plinko versions commonly offer tiered risk levels, influencing the range and frequency of multipliers. Understanding these levels is key to tailoring a gameplay strategy based on preferred risk tolerance.
Risk Levels and Payout Structures
One of the most prominent features of plinko is the variability in risk levels. Players can typically choose from options like ‘low risk’, ‘medium risk’, and ‘high risk’, each influencing the payout distribution. Low-risk levels generally have more frequent but smaller wins, representing a more conservative approach. Medium-risk levels offer a balance between frequency and payout size, while high-risk levels present fewer but significantly larger winning opportunities.
The structure of payouts is directly linked to game variation but broadly follows a pattern – central slots generally offer lower multipliers with higher hit probability, while the outer slots feature substantial multipliers coupled with decreased odds of striking them. The Evolution of Plinko in Online Casinos
Initially inspired by the “The Price is Right” television show’s iconic Plinko board, the online casino version has undergone considerable advancement. Earlier iterations of the game are compared to the video game style now, with graphics and added features. Modern plinko games incorporate intricate animations, custom themes, and bonus rounds to offer a richer gaming experience.
This evolution also involves integrating advanced random number generators (RNGs) to ensure fairness and transparency. These RNGs undergo rigorous testing to guarantee their impartiality, assuring that every play delivers a legitimate and unpredicted outcome. Some online casinos even present live plinko versions, often hosted by live dealers, to provide a more immersive and realistic gaming environment.
